Oliviero Carafa

Cardinal
Oliviero Carafa, in Latin Oliverius Carafa, was an Italian cardinal and diplomat of the Renaissance. Like the majority of his era's prelates, he displayed the lavish and conspicuous standard of living that was expected of a prince of the Church. Wikipedia
Born: March 10, 1430, Naples, Italy
Died: January 20, 1511 (age 80 years), Rome, Italy
Created cardinal: 18 September 1467; by Pope Paul II
